Naplex things to remember correctly answered 2023CYP INHIBITORS 
*G PACMAN* 
Grapefruit 
Protease inhibitors (Ritonavir) 
Azole antifungals 
C - cyclosporine, cimetidine, cobicistat 
Macrolides (NOT azithromycin) 
Amiodarone (and dronedarone) 
Non-DHP CCBs 
 
 
 
CYP INDUCERS 
*PS PORCS* 
Phenytoin 
Smoking 
Phenobarbital 
Oxcarbazepine (and eslicarbazepine) 
Rifampin 
Carbamazepine (also auto-inducer) 
St. Johns wort 
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
Digoxin Levels 
0.8-2 (Afib) 
0.5-0.9 (HF)
